The Kennedy Catholic Lancers will face off against the Stadium Tigers at 4:00 p.m. on Monday. Kennedy Catholic is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 6.2 runs per game this season.
Stadium is facing Kennedy Catholic at the wrong time: Kennedy Catholic suffered their first home loss of the season on Saturday and they're likely out for redemption. They fell just short of the Beavers by a score of 4-3.
Kennedy Catholic got a good showing from Quinn Bundy, who tossed three innings while giving up no earned runs off three hits. That's the first time Bundy hasn't allowed a single earned run since back in March.
At the plate, Dante Saladino made the most of his time at bat despite the final result and got on base in two of his four plate appearances with one stolen base, one run, and one RBI.
Meanwhile, Stadium was not able to break out of their rough patch on Wednesday as the team picked up their third straight defeat. They were two runs away from ending the streak, but they lost a 7-5 heartbreaker at the hands of Tahoma.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est loss the Tigers have suffered since April 9th.
Stadium sa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Raider Pula, who went 1-for-2 with two runs and one stolen base.
Stadium's defeat dropped their record down to 4-12. As for Kennedy Catholic, their loss dropped their record down to 12-7.
